rounds one two and three all had perfectly good rules, though rounds one and two were horribly unbalanced (war frigates and cruisers were a complete waste in round 1, everything but thieves were a complete waste in two)
making a completely useless ship didn't ruin a round though, people had the option of not producing it. the piggy-backing rules of round 4 made it completely pointless to roid anyone who wasn't stupid, and scrap made it completely useless to try to wipe out anyone at all.
ps: the reason i don't play is that anyone who isn't in a major alliance hasn't been able to compete since round 4.
